Informational Webinar Set for July 20th

Learn more about the new Rural and Tribal Assistance Pilot Program at an informational webinar hosted by the Build America Bureau. The Bureau released the notice of funding opportunity on June 15th, announcing $3.4 million in grants available on a first-come, first-served basis beginning August 14th at 2 p.m. ET. The best part, the grants DO NOT require any matching funds from the grantee.

Not sure if your project is rural? 

Your project is eligible if: 

The project is not in a Census Bureau 2020 designated urban area.
OR - The project is in a Census Bureau 2020 designated urban area with a population of 150,000 or less. 

Your project is not eligible if it is in a Census Bureau 2020 designated urban area that has a population of more than 150,000 people.
